#25bbda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25bbda is composed of 14.5% red, 73.3%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 190.3 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 50%. #25bbda color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#0077b5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#25bbda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#25bbda has RGB values of R:37, G:187,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2472922.

Hex triplet 25bbda #25bbda
RGB Decimal 37, 187, 218 rgb(37,187,218)
RGB Percent 14.5, 73.3, 85.5 rgb(14.5%,73.3%,85.5%)
CMYK 83, 14, 0, 15
HSL 190.3°, 71, 50 hsl(190.3,71%,50%)
HSV (or HSB) 190.3°, 83, 85.5
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 70.171, -26.571, -26.15
XYZ 31.185, 40.993, 72.595
xyY 0.215, 0.283, 40.993
CIE-LCH 70.171, 37.281, 224.543
CIE-LUV 70.171, -48.752, -37.637
Hunter-Lab 64.026, -25.104, -22.407
Binary 00100101, 10111011,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#25bbda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#25bbda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8182 is the less saturated color, while #08cef7 is the most saturated one.
